Adjusting the Mini Lathe 1. Clean off the protective grease on the Mini Lathe. 2. Check to see that the three set screws on the chuck are tight. 3. T urn the chuck by hand and check that it rotates freely . 4. Move the Feeding Direction Selector (located on the back of lathe) to the middle.
Replacement of Jaws There are two types of jaws: the internal jaws and external jaws. Please note that the number of jaws fit with the number inside the chuck’ s groove. Do not mix them together . When you are going to mount the jaws, mount them in ascending order .
T ool Post Adjustment Loosen the lever shown in (B) of figure 1 1, the adjust the tool post position. Once the adjustment is made, re-tighten the lever . T o replace the work cutter , loosen the screws (A) with the allen wrench provided. Automatic Feeding Adjust the feeding direction selector to the direction you desire.
3. By changing the tool post angle and adjusting the compound rest, you can do internal cutting (figure 15). 4. After adjusting the angle of the compound rest, you can do bevel cutting (figure 16). Additional Set-Up Instructions for Threading Gears When the lathe is ON and the Spindle is revolving, the threaded bar and the Thread Dial Indicator will also be revolving (see below). Insure that the Alignment Mark is lined up with the Thread Dial Indicator before operation.
